Barclays Downgrades CF Industries

Singkham / Getty Images

Fintel reports that on August 14, 2023, Barclays downgraded their outlook for CF Industries Holdings (NYSE:CF) from Overweight to Equal-Weight.

Analyst Price Forecast Suggests 7.72% Upside

As of August 2, 2023, the average one-year price target for CF Industries Holdings is 86.06. The forecasts range from a low of 65.65 to a high of $110.25. The average price target represents an increase of 7.72% from its latest reported closing price of 79.89.

CF Industries Holdings Declares $0.40 Dividend

On July 6, 2023 the company declared a regular quarterly dividend of $0.40 per share ($1.60 annualized). Shareholders of record as of August 15, 2023 will receive the payment on August 31, 2023. Previously, the company paid $0.40 per share.

At the current share price of $79.89 / share, the stock’s dividend yield is 2.00%.

Looking back five years and taking a sample every week, the average dividend yield has been 2.55%, the lowest has been 1.09%, and the highest has been 5.44%. The standard deviation of yields is 0.81 (n=236).

The current dividend yield is 0.67 standard deviations below the historical average.

Additionally, the company’s dividend payout ratio is 0.13. The payout ratio tells us how much of a company’s income is paid out in dividends. A payout ratio of one (1.0) means 100% of the company’s income is paid in a dividend. A payout ratio greater than one means the company is dipping into savings in order to maintain its dividend – not a healthy situation. Companies with few growth prospects are expected to pay out most of their income in dividends, which typically means a payout ratio between 0.5 and 1.0. Companies with good growth prospects are expected to retain some earnings in order to invest in those growth prospects, which translates to a payout ratio of zero to 0.5.

The company’s 3-Year dividend growth rate is 0.33%, demonstrating that it has increased its dividend over time.

CF Industries Holdings Background Information
(This description is provided by the company.)

CF Industries Holdings Inc. is a leading global manufacturer of hydrogen and nitrogen products for clean energy, emissions abatement, fertilizer, and other industrial applications. The company operates manufacturing complexes in the United States, Canada, and the United Kingdom, which are among the most cost-advantaged, efficient, and flexible in the world, and an unparalleled storage, transportation and distribution network in North America. Its 3,000 employees focus on safe and reliable operations, environmental stewardship and disciplined capital and corporate management, driving its strategy to leverage and sustainably grow the world’s most advantaged hydrogen and nitrogen platform to serve customers, creating long-term shareholder value.
